This Insignia has water in the boot, which we traced to one rear vent, which is resulting in wet carpets throughout the car.
Due to the age of the car, the rear vents could be leaking because they have perished, but there is evidence that the rear of the car has had a nudge which could have caused it on one side.
The water is flowing into the boot, but also running down the box section into the driver's side footwells.
We would recommend replacing both rear vents to stop the leak. The car then should be dried to prevent mould and electrical problems.
